Congratulations to all the films and actors, but its great to see that there is a lot more diversity in this year’s nominations. You can watch the nominations below, or scroll down and read them for yourself.
LaLa land scored 14 nominations, creating a record, but “Moonlight” was right behind them with 7.Special Congratulations to Ava DuVernay, Octavia Spencer, Denzel Washington, Violoa Davis, Naomie Harris, Mahershala Ali, James Laxton, Dev Patel; and to the films “Moonlight,”Fences,” “Hidden Figures,” “13th,” and “I Am Not Your Negro.”
